Rita J. Gosselin

LEWISTON – Rita J. Gosselin, 87, passed away on Wednesday, July 23, 2025 at CMMC. She was born in Lewiston on May 31, 1938 to Arthur J. Gosselin and Delia (Hamel) Gosselin. Rita was one of nine children. She lived all her life in Lewiston She attended St. Peters School and graduated from St. Dom’s in 1957.

She worked in the office at Knapp Shoe for 37 years and then for TD Bank for 17 years, retiring at age 80. Rita had deep faith and was proud of her French heritage.

She was a member of the singing group Les Troubadours. Rita volunteered at the Franco Center and St. Mary’s Hospital. She loved to watch the Bruins and Patriots play on TV. Rita enjoyed cooking for her family on holidays and traveling with friends.

Rita was predeceased by her parents, brothers Roland, Bob, Armand and Roger Gosselin, sister Therese Giem. sisters-in-law Pauline, Shirley and Laurette Gosselin, brother-in-law Richard Giem, and her dear friend Alliette Couturier.

She is survived by her brothers Raymond Gosselin, Lucien (Anna Rose) Gosselin and Maurice (Linda) Gosselin; many nieces and nephews.
